首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

VB.net-VSTO-12身份证号归属地区功能演示

VB.net-VSTO-12身份证号归属地区功能演示 问题 一个身份证号,如何取得身份证号归属地区身份证号的信息是这样的 身份证号码18位,按照从左到右的顺序,各个数字的代表的含义依次为: (1)...前1、2位数字表示: 所在省份的代码; (2)第3、4位数字表示: 所在城市的代码; (3)第5、6位数字表示:...所在区县的代码; (4)第7~14位数字表示: 出生年、月、日; (5)第15、16位数字表示: 所在地的派出所的代码; (6)第...完成效果 功能演示 全屏横屏观看效果更好 身份证号归属地区功能演示,本功能数据来源于网络,请谨慎使用 关键代码 首先在网上收集地区代码数据,整理,去重,再存入字典,再对每一个身份证号取前6位,匹配相应的地区就可以啦...字典 方法 代码解析 首先在网上收集地区代码数据,整理,去重,再存入字典,再对每一个身份证号取前6位,匹配相应的地区就可以啦, 我把数据整合到一个类文件中,调用时要先初始化类,先要校验身份证号是否正确

10510
您找到你想要的搜索结果了吗?
是的
没有找到

java验证身份证号码是否有效源代码

1、描述 用java语言判断身份证号码是否有效,地区码、出身年月、校验码等验证算法 2、源代码 package test; import java.text.ParseException...* (1)前1、2位数字表示:所在省份的代码; * (2)第3、4位数字表示:所在城市的代码; * (3)第5、6位数字表示:所在区县的代码; * (4)第7~14...位数字表示:出生年、月、日; * (5)第15、16位数字表示:所在地的派出所的代码; * (6)第17位数字表示性别:奇数表示男性,偶数表示女性 * (7)第18...areacode = GetAreaCode(); //如果身份证前两位的地区码不在Hashtable,则地区码有误 if (areacode.get...(Ai.substring(0, 2)) == null) { tipInfo = "身份证地区编码错误。"

97900

二代身份证编码规则及校验代码实现

本文主要讨论的是二代身份证编码规则及其Java代码实现,下面的校验方式还不是特别严谨,由于只校验了前两位的省份信息,中间六位的出生日期信息和最后一位的校验码信息,故对于部分不满足要求的证件号码刚好同时满足了这里提到的几个条件...,也会被判定为是合法的证件号码… 1 二代身份证号码编码规则 1.1 编码格式 1999年我国颁发了第二代居民身份证号,公民身份号码为18位,且终身不变。...居民身份证格式如:ABCDEFYYYYMMDDXXXR 1.1.1地址码(ABCDEF) 表示登记户口时所在地的行政区划代码(省、市、县),如果行政区划进行了重新划分,同一个地方进行户口登记的可能存在地址码不一致的情况...行政区划代码按GB/T2260的规定执行。...当我们输入身份号码进行实名认证的时候,根据校验码算法可以初步判断你输入身份证号码格式是否正确。

1.5K20

56行Python代码实现身份证字典生成器

地址码表示编码对象常住户口所在县(市、旗、区)的行政区划代码,按GB/T2260的规定执行。 出生日期码表示编码对象出生的年、月、日,按GB/T7408的规定执行,年、月、日代码之间不用分隔符。...fromtitle=身份证号码&fromid=2135487 0x02 校验码规则 1、将前面的身份证号码17位数分别乘以不同的系数。...例如:某男性的身份证号码是34052419800101001X。我们要看看这个身份证是不是合法的身份证。...这样列出来的男性身份证号的字典有500种可能,女性身份证号码的字典则有499种可能。 0x04 代码分析 import os #根据地址码,出生日期码,性别生成身份证号码字典函数。...IDCard_dictionary/" + address + birthday + sex + ".txt") if __name__ == "__main__": main() 0x05 写在最后 本文源代码链接

9.7K30

Oracle 关于身份证校验规则详细说明(附有代码复制可执行)

身份证号码组成 15位身份证号组成: 省份(2位)市(2位)区[县](2位)年(2位)月(2位)日(2位)+3位序列号 [奇数给男性/偶数给女性] 18位身份证号组成: 省份(2位)市(2位)区[县](...10做尾号,那么此人的身份证就变成了19位,而19位的号码违反了国家标准,并且中国的计算机用用系统也不承认19位的身份证号码。...如果余数是10,就会在身份证的第18位数字上出现的是2。 例如:某男性的身份证号码 我们要看看这个身份证是不是合法的身份证。...可以判定这是一个合格的身份证号码。...--返回-2:表示身份证位数有误。   --返回-3:表示出生日期有误或者身份证含有不正确的信息。   --返回-4:表示身份证最后一位校验位有误。

1.7K20

ruby连接mysql代码

在ubuntu中安装mysql环境很简单,只需要以下几条命令: 1. sudo apt-get install mysql-serve 2. apt-get isntall mysql-client...sudo apt-get install libmysqlclient-dev 检查mysql安装成功 sudo netstat -tap | grep mysql 通过上述命令检查之后,如果看到有mysql...登录mysql: mysql -u root -p 接下来会提示输入密码 具体方法参见点击打开链接 mysql安装完毕,接下来要安装两个工具 1.dbi ------即database interface...dbi 安装mysql驱动 gem install dbd-mysql 接下来安装mysql客户端api gem install mysql2 上面这条命令我目前还没有搞明白它的用途,但是接下来我会有一段时间执行这条命令...( gem install mysql)会报错,后来把mysql改成了mysql2,并且把路径切换到了项目路径下,然后就成功了

1.3K20

GitHub Copilot生成代码包含身份证号,B站CEO无端躺枪

AI自动补全代码,结果补出来了一张别人的身份证? GitHub Copilot又出神操作了。 有人在推特上晒图,表示自己在使用GitHub Copilot时,它竟然给补全出了一张身份证信息出来。...输入B站CEO陈睿的信息后,下方竟然自动补出了身份证号。 这操作确实够吓人的。 网友就表示:恐成社工库利器啊! ?...也就是说,这串所谓的身份证号,其实是GitHub Copilot自动生成的假数据。 这让人们提起来的心稍微放下了一些。 但是原本是生成代码的GitHub Copilot,怎么会生成个人隐私信息呢?...而对于GPT-3、BERT这些超大型语言模型来说,训练数据集的来源往往包罗万象,大部分是从网络公共信息中抓取,其中免不了个人敏感信息,比如姓名、地址、身份证号等等。...△GitHub Copilot复刻Quake代码 另一方面,GitHub Copilot是由数十亿行公开代码训练的。 有人认为,这可能是训练集中的原始代码就违反了相关隐私条款。

1.2K60

贫困地区人口信息管理系统 毕业设计 JAVA+Vue+SpringBoot+MySQL

一、摘要 1.1 项目介绍 基于JAVA+Vue+SpringBoot+MySQL的贫困地区人口信息管理系统,包含了贫困人口管理、精准扶贫管理、贫困家庭支出统计、特殊群体、贫困户子女信息、案件信息、物资补助申领模块...,后端采用Spring Boot框架,采用MySQL数据库。...2.5 物资补助模块 贫困地区人口信息管理系统需要物资补助模块,这是由于贫困地区的人民生活水平低下,许多人要靠政府和其它机构的物质救济才能勉强糊口。...三、系统设计 3.1 用例设计 3.2 数据库设计 3.2.1 人口表 3.2.2 扶贫表 3.2.3 特殊群体表 3.2.4 案件表 3.2.5 物资补助表 四、系统展示 五、核心代码 5.1 查询企事业单位...下载本系统代码或使用本系统的用户,必须同意以下内容,否则请勿下载! 出于自愿而使用/开发本软件,了解使用本软件的风险,且同意自己承担使用本软件的风险。

36850

MySQL Shell系列——执行代码

在这一系列的文章里,将详细向读者介绍MySQL Shell的各种使用方法。这一篇将介绍如何使用MySQL Shell执行代码。...一、执行模式 MySQL Shell可以执行 SQL、JavaScript和Python代码,但同一时间只能激活一种语言。MySQL Shell执行操作时支持交互模式和批处理模式,默认使用交互模式。...Shell具有代码自动填充功能,在任何语言的交互模式下,可以使用TAB键进行代码填充。...四、代码历史 MySQL Shell能够将输入的命令或代码进行存储。用户可以通过箭头键进行前后的翻找,也可以使用Ctrl+R向后查找,Ctrl+S向前查找,Ctrl+C取消查找。...Shell执行代码的内容,如果需要了解更为详细的内容,请访问官网手册“https://dev.mysql.com/doc/mysql-shell/8.0/en/mysql-shell-code-execution.html

1.5K20

Mysql错误代码大全

MYSQL不能删除数据库文件导致删除数据库失败 1010:MYSQL不能删除数据目录导致删除数据库失败 1011:MYSQL删除数据库文件失败 1012:MYSQL不能读取系统表中的记录 1020:MYSQL...1045:MYSQL不能连接数据库,用户名或密码错误 1048:MYSQL字段不能为空 1049:MYSQL数据库不存在 1050:MYSQL数据表已存在 1051:MYSQL数据表不存在 1054:...MYSQL字段不存在 1065:MYSQL无效的SQL语句,SQL语句为空 1081:MYSQL不能建立Socket连接 1114:MYSQL数据表已满,不能容纳任何记录 1116:MYSQL打开的数据表太多...MYSQL当前用户无权访问数据表 1143:MYSQL当前用户无权访问数据表中的字段 1146:MYSQL数据表不存在 1147:MYSQL未定义用户对数据表的访问权限 1149:MYSQL语句语法错误...字段值重复,入库失败 1169:MYSQL字段值重复,更新记录失败 1177:MYSQL打开数据表失败 1180:MYSQL提交事务失败 1181:MYSQL回滚事务失败 1203:MYSQL当前用户和数据库建立的连接已到达数据库的最大连接数

4.6K40
领券